Skip to main content

Random random events for probabilistic reasoning

Project description

Welcome to the Random Events package!

Probabilistic Machine Learning frequently requires descriptions of random variables and events that are shared among many packages. This package provides a common interface for describing random variables and events, using usable and easily extensible classes.

Installation:

For Users:

Install the package via

pip install random-events

For Developers:

Create your own fork of the original repository and clone the fork.

git clone *ADDRESS_OF_YOUR_FORK*

Move into the repository and initialize the submodules.

cd random-events
git submodule update --init --recursive

Now, install all requirements.

pip install -r requirements-dev.txt

Usage and Guides:

Check out the documentation.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

random_events-5.0.2.tar.gz (32.6 kB view details)

Uploaded Source

Built Distributions

If you're not sure about the file name format, learn more about wheel file names.

random_events-5.0.2-cp312-cp312-manylinux2014_x86_64.manylinux_2_17_x86_64.whl (322.3 kB view details)

Uploaded CPython 3.12manylinux: glibc 2.17+ x86-64

random_events-5.0.2-cp311-cp311-manylinux2014_x86_64.manylinux_2_17_x86_64.whl (321.5 kB view details)

Uploaded CPython 3.11manylinux: glibc 2.17+ x86-64

random_events-5.0.2-cp310-cp310-manylinux_2_17_x86_64.manylinux2014_x86_64.whl (320.6 kB view details)

Uploaded CPython 3.10manylinux: glibc 2.17+ x86-64

random_events-5.0.2-cp39-cp39-manylinux_2_17_x86_64.manylinux2014_x86_64.whl (320.9 kB view details)

Uploaded CPython 3.9manylinux: glibc 2.17+ x86-64

random_events-5.0.2-cp38-cp38-manylinux_2_17_x86_64.manylinux2014_x86_64.whl (319.9 kB view details)

Uploaded CPython 3.8manylinux: glibc 2.17+ x86-64

File details

Details for the file random_events-5.0.2.tar.gz.

File metadata

  • Download URL: random_events-5.0.2.tar.gz
  • Upload date:
  • Size: 32.6 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.13.12

File hashes

Hashes for random_events-5.0.2.tar.gz
Algorithm Hash digest
SHA256 3d8c4516e4bad565a10d4ed9a9087a7be05e9a9edad8ef1eaabfe6cd982e17f7
MD5 eb3809d2f2c957525995597685ea1117
BLAKE2b-256 8819bdd7e932677e24ac1d1d743e9b49ef1ce464ad363b15e710b677a1749b8d

See more details on using hashes here.

Provenance

The following attestation bundles were made for random_events-5.0.2.tar.gz:

Publisher: random_events-publish-to-pypi.yml on cram2/cognitive_robot_abstract_machine

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file random_events-5.0.2-cp312-cp312-manylinux2014_x86_64.manylinux_2_17_x86_64.whl.

File metadata

File hashes

Hashes for random_events-5.0.2-cp312-cp312-manylinux2014_x86_64.manylinux_2_17_x86_64.whl
Algorithm Hash digest
SHA256 83ce3ec01fb0b933d5d0e720e4e2b2ab879f17d7a2be55905e30f8b5f798b161
MD5 457c4ab6e66ced4d478a43a30787984e
BLAKE2b-256 caf8535d3259ec6f8857f1eed363c83bc31ad2a9b8cae6d99c82ecbbf679e2c4

See more details on using hashes here.

Provenance

The following attestation bundles were made for random_events-5.0.2-cp312-cp312-manylinux2014_x86_64.manylinux_2_17_x86_64.whl:

Publisher: random_events-publish-to-pypi.yml on cram2/cognitive_robot_abstract_machine

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file random_events-5.0.2-cp311-cp311-manylinux2014_x86_64.manylinux_2_17_x86_64.whl.

File metadata

File hashes

Hashes for random_events-5.0.2-cp311-cp311-manylinux2014_x86_64.manylinux_2_17_x86_64.whl
Algorithm Hash digest
SHA256 ba79ab170f7a26ab63b947609e3baec8ba32f7241816d76d1b2dcbaae85a5839
MD5 be00b30fbd320a2efb77dac6794818ed
BLAKE2b-256 59088ee501c8f68b3461071a1cdf9ab14b1acedcaa2cf355ab7eda43987e0b65

See more details on using hashes here.

Provenance

The following attestation bundles were made for random_events-5.0.2-cp311-cp311-manylinux2014_x86_64.manylinux_2_17_x86_64.whl:

Publisher: random_events-publish-to-pypi.yml on cram2/cognitive_robot_abstract_machine

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file random_events-5.0.2-cp310-cp310-manylinux_2_17_x86_64.manylinux2014_x86_64.whl.

File metadata

File hashes

Hashes for random_events-5.0.2-cp310-cp310-manylinux_2_17_x86_64.man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 5a5f6e46d6b626cf8a1740b2eae32e7fc18afc6fdddbdfbf6f04492600b1129e
MD5 57a67fbf54ad7dc3217e5f87aba750fb
BLAKE2b-256 419153fd0d1aabb3cb9b4bf55b5a9fb92731d639be6281c8f98329efc2058681

See more details on using hashes here.

Provenance

The following attestation bundles were made for random_events-5.0.2-cp310-cp310-manylinux_2_17_x86_64.manylinux2014_x86_64.whl:

Publisher: random_events-publish-to-pypi.yml on cram2/cognitive_robot_abstract_machine

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file random_events-5.0.2-cp39-cp39-manylinux_2_17_x86_64.manylinux2014_x86_64.whl.

File metadata

File hashes

Hashes for random_events-5.0.2-cp39-cp39-manylinux_2_17_x86_64.man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 e7c79a9e7ed9a8c44a9638eaec8fbfc1e025b8758a93a5e0b0085e452c92b2ff
MD5 9e2769159ba327b737ac09add5c456a2
BLAKE2b-256 438b77c16878baddfef1418966ff6b374c2259845188d66b37611f485b1de21f

See more details on using hashes here.

Provenance

The following attestation bundles were made for random_events-5.0.2-cp39-cp39-manylinux_2_17_x86_64.manylinux2014_x86_64.whl:

Publisher: random_events-publish-to-pypi.yml on cram2/cognitive_robot_abstract_machine

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file random_events-5.0.2-cp38-cp38-manylinux_2_17_x86_64.manylinux2014_x86_64.whl.

File metadata

File hashes

Hashes for random_events-5.0.2-cp38-cp38-manylinux_2_17_x86_64.man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 3099c817bd5a7998d0416d1d6c374ca2c9b6a487304de7bafd9d33da42b85b5d
MD5 72d8ce70aae097782fcda3cf0fd22107
BLAKE2b-256 360d9765827757618cb580d6fb8cff87d02bf3e10080c79c27bafa93220ae4d3

See more details on using hashes here.

Provenance

The following attestation bundles were made for random_events-5.0.2-cp38-cp38-manylinux_2_17_x86_64.manylinux2014_x86_64.whl:

Publisher: random_events-publish-to-pypi.yml on cram2/cognitive_robot_abstract_machine

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page